Output 506334df72ec9832e10805f5aa3347982a0b298c312f3a6cc4c4f3853aebd47d:6

value
89886307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f624740d02e41515a3434e1e65e3425a038031 OP_EQUAL
address
MKf3bFv3e2RYJWvDaZEFJwivphhTwwy2pu
transaction
506334df72ec9832e10805f5aa3347982a0b298c312f3a6cc4c4f3853aebd47d
spent
true